Manufactured from 16 gauge galvanized steel blade and frame. Heavy duty interlocking blades and fully enclosed blade linkage mechanism. Contrasted with stainless steel lateral blade seals and 59If lubricating sintered bronze bushed. Details : All corners of the frame are fully welded (and painted to prevent rust) to ensure sturdy construction for a rattle free operation. Designed for parallel blade operation. AMFSD series combination Fire/Smoke dampers are UL 555/555S classified, manufactured under Airmaster’s strict quality control procedures. AMFSD Dampers are available with Class II leakage rating at 2000fpm (10.2m/s) / 4”w.g (1000pa). Suitable for most of the commercial smoke management applications in both static and dynamic systems. All actuators are externally mounted with 230VAC as standard. Actuators are supplied without auxiliary switch as standard. Actuator position will be based on Clockwise (CW) closure direction as standard. TRD’s have an inbuilt RESET switch to reopen the damper. All AMFSD models are factory fitted with 400mm wide & 1.2mm thick steel sleeve as standard. All dampers and TRD’s are factory tested to ensure smooth operation before dispatch. Actuators have to be configured with control panel or BMS system for smoke control applications before commissioning. Can be used in walls/partitions of less than 3 hours fire resistance rating as per NFPA 90-A in accordance with ANSI/UL555 standards. Fire dampers are passive fire protection products used in heating, ventilation, and air conditioning (hvac) ducts to prevent the spread of fire inside the duct work through fire-resistance rated walls and floors.
